A joint team of Ministers will visit Aralam Farm in Kannur next month to assess the ongoing measures aimed at reducing human-wildlife conflicts. The team will have Forest Minister Shibu Baby John, Electricity and Environment Minister and local MLA Sunny Joseph, SC/ST and Backward Classes Development Minister K.A. Thulasi, and Public Works Minister P.K. Basheer.
The decision was taken at a meeting convened by the Forest Minister in Thiruvananthapuram on Thursday. The meeting directed that the construction of the elephant-proof wall at Aralam Farm, which is being monitored by the Kerala High Court, should be completed by December.
The meeting reviewed the progress of undergrowth clearing and vista clearance. It was also decided that the rehabilitation programme at Aralam Farm should be completed
within a stipulated timeframe.
